This weeks question:
What books have recently made you cry?
I get a little misty eyed over a lot of the books I read but two really got me choked up recently...
Karen Marie Moning's the Immortal Highlander and Robyn Carr's A Virgin River Christmas. Kinda random and totally different styles but amazing books. They'd have me laughing one second and then completely bawling like a baby the next. The ending of the Immortal Highlander. Pfew. Yeah. Total mess. And Carr's book just about did me in. I had to put it down a couple of times because I so teary eyed I couldn't see the words anymore. The emotional pain and trauma the heroine/hero are dealing with [the death of her husband and his best friend] was just staggering and so well written. Damn. I'm getting all teared up again just thinking about them. Fantastic books/series/authors.
